Like here, not only does trading make the game more complicated, it makes no sense. For example, say Person A wants to trade the last pick in the 1st round to Person B, for the first pick in the 2nd round.

Round 1
19. Person C
20. Person A

Round 2
1. Person B
2.....

"Oh Boy!" Person A says excitingly as he gains the first pick in the 2nd round, when in reality, all he did was trade his 20th draft pick, for the 21st draft pick. This is why it doesn't make sense to swap draft picks to be given back at a later round.

The problem is the power always goes the people at the top of the draft list. But reversing the order each round, balances the power out to everyone and leaves the game more based on skill. Where as it is now, 80% of your chance of winning is based on your SuperBowl prediction, and only 20% of your chance of winning is based on the actual game. After the draft order is calculated, you might as well drop the bottom half of it, as they have little to no chance of winning.
